POSITION SUMMARY This position is responsible for guiding and supporting health information functions and services at designated facility(s) or functional areas within Banner Health. This position will support the achievement of assigned key performance indicators, including data analysis and development of action plans when needed. The role is responsible for successfully managing the operational activities of Health Information Management Services (HIMS), including hiring staff, goal setting and performance measurement, monitoring and measuring staff competencies, assigning work, training staff, and corrective action. This position promotes a collaborative, open, and inclusive work environment within a highly integrated organization on matters related to health information operations. This position may work with facility leadership related to facility-specific issues and opportunities. This position will identify opportunities for workflows to enhance related functions, which will be provided to upline leader(s) for consideration.
